[oe-commits] org.oe.dev linux-dht-walnut: switch to uImage

koen commit openembedded-commits at lists.openembedded.org
Wed Dec 26 17:34:44 UTC 2007


linux-dht-walnut: switch to uImage

Author: koen at openembedded.org
Branch: org.openembedded.dev
Revision: dad602c71259168fe486c82459bf119f6c69c69a
ViewMTN: http://monotone.openembedded.org/revision/info/dad602c71259168fe486c82459bf119f6c69c69a
Files:
1
conf/machine/dht-walnut.conf
packages/linux/linux-dht-walnut_2.6.20.bb
Diffs:

#
# mt diff -ra211ba42d2c74bcac9e9a4c50701a9b2505b8f34 -rdad602c71259168fe486c82459bf119f6c69c69a
#
# 
# 
# patch "conf/machine/dht-walnut.conf"
#  from [e5c261408b4bffd85b8ef78c4dbd1857c950efe6]
#    to [00c13b5bc54642ac7b5813d3c828023ff3c7885b]
# 
# patch "packages/linux/linux-dht-walnut_2.6.20.bb"
#  from [032566f5149e9d714c6631ead6e1db18ccb1dc26]
#    to [f74a2fd1c0fda2557e86d75f9b0cc1b9ad131c4f]
# 
============================================================
--- conf/machine/dht-walnut.conf	e5c261408b4bffd85b8ef78c4dbd1857c950efe6
+++ conf/machine/dht-walnut.conf	00c13b5bc54642ac7b5813d3c828023ff3c7885b
@@ -20,6 +20,7 @@ PREFERRED_VERSION_u-boot = "1.1.4"
 SERIAL_CONSOLE = "115200 ttyS0"
 
 PREFERRED_VERSION_u-boot = "1.1.4"
+KERNEL_IMAGETYPE = "uImage"
 
 #tune for the 405 cpu
 require conf/machine/include/tune-ppc405.inc
============================================================
--- packages/linux/linux-dht-walnut_2.6.20.bb	032566f5149e9d714c6631ead6e1db18ccb1dc26
+++ packages/linux/linux-dht-walnut_2.6.20.bb	f74a2fd1c0fda2557e86d75f9b0cc1b9ad131c4f
@@ -18,7 +18,6 @@ ARCH = "ppc"
 
 export OS = "Linux"
 ARCH = "ppc"
-KERNEL_OUTPUT = "arch/ppc/boot/images/zImage.elf"
 
 do_stage_append () {
 #need ppc platforms includes + friends in order for external kernel modules to compile as headers as still split
@@ -33,8 +32,11 @@ do_install_append () {
 
 do_install_append () {
         install -d  ${DEPLOY_DIR_IMAGE}
-        install -m 0755 arch/ppc/boot/images/zImage.elf \ 
+	if [ -e arch/ppc/boot/images/zImage.elf ] ; then
+	    cp -a arch/ppc/boot/images/zImage.elf arch/ppc/boot/images/zImage
+            install -m 0755 arch/ppc/boot/images/zImage.elf \ 
                 ${DEPLOY_DIR_IMAGE}/${KERNEL_IMAGETYPE}-${PV}-${MACHINE}-${DATETIME}.elf
+	fi	
         install -m 0755 vmlinux ${DEPLOY_DIR_IMAGE}/
 }
 






More information about the Openembedded-commits mailing list